From Estcourt Roots to Global Recognition
Hailing from Estcourt, KwaZulu-Natal, LaTique began his musical journey in 2012, drawing inspiration from his older brother and a passion for keys and production. Initially releasing music under the alias ‘Harmony’, he rebranded in 2017, unveiling the deeper, more sophisticated sonic persona that the industry now recognizes. His catalogue has since expanded through acclaimed labels such as Atjazz Record Company, House Afrika, and Stay True Sounds, alongside the growth of his own imprint, RVRE Recording Company.
A Sonic Tapestry of Afro-Tech and Deep House
Winter Tone is a cohesive body of work layered with emotion, rhythm, and innovation. It includes standout track Ixesha, a collaboration with Mdu aka TRP featuring Zimvo, that fuses tribal house, amapiano elements, and LaTique’s deep house roots into a powerful and contemporary offering. Zimvo’s stirring vocals and the percussive heartbeat of the track exemplify LaTique’s hybrid sonic vision.
Focus Tracks That Speak to the Soul
Two other EP highlights—Amber and Excuses—showcase the emotional range and sonic depth of LaTique’s production. Ethereal vocals, warm chord progressions, and atmospheric synths anchor both tracks. Excuses introduces a subtle log drum element, hinting at the ‘private school piano’ aesthetic without veering from LaTique’s core deep house sound. These songs serve as emotional cornerstones of the EP.

Notable Collaborations Add Texture and Soul
The project also brings in a stellar lineup of collaborators. Jonga Le features the smooth, expressive vocals of Sia Mzizi, while Let Go—produced alongside Mafia Natives—delivers a cinematic, groove-driven track that adds narrative weight to the EP. Each collaboration contributes to the layered storytelling that defines Winter Tone.
